Job Location | Weybridge |
Education | Not Mentioned |
Salary | 25,000 - 28,000 per annum |
Industry | Not Mentioned |
Functional Area | Not Mentioned |
Job Type | Permanent , full-time |
Accounts Assistant Weybridge £28,0000My client a global leader in their field are seeking an experienced and eager to learn Accounts assistant to support the Accounts Receivable and Accounts Payable function for their EMEA and APAC entities.Key Responsibilities:Coordinate documentation required to invoice UK and Australian customers.Manage credit control for UK customers including liaising with the Account Management team and answering queries.Send weekly status reports to the Accounts Managers.Keep up to date with payments and review aged debtors.Using a Centralised Account Payable service centre, assist with processing vendor invoices that are received from our global offices and enter into the accounting system.Monitor the supplier records on the system.Processing employee expenses on the internal expense reporting system on Lotus Notes, ensuring adherence to the company expenses policy.Upload employee expenses into the accounting system.Prepare weekly vendor payment files for uploading to our banking system.Ensure prompt and timely payment.Maintain regular and accurate filing system for all paperwork.Manage pre-payment of overseas accommodation.Qualifications & Skills Holding a minimum of AAT Level 2 or educated to A-level.Very good knowledge of Microsoft Excel and Word, Lotus Notes, Microsoft Dynamics 365 (or other accounting package).Good level of numeracy, enjoy working with figures and detail-oriented.Excellent English language skills, both spoken and written and able to communicate professionally and effectively with colleagues via email and in person.Good administration skills and with a mature attitude, who is happy taking on responsibility and able to jump in to deal with basic admin/logistics tasks outside of main remit.Able to meet the strict deadlines of the weekly payment run with a high degree of accuracy and reliability; working well under pressure and able to juggle priorities to meet deadlines.Willing to take on project work when necessary and work to the required deadlines.Able to respond to inquiries from people in a range of time zones in a timely manner.Discreet, dependable and respectful of specific procedures and confidentiality.Able to work independently with the minimal need for supervision.Confident working in a multicultural, international and dynamic environment
